**Handover — Snapcrate thumbnail queue (from Priya-shift to Oleg-shift)**

For the release manager: the Snapcrate thumbnail generation queue is drained and the resize workers are pinned to version 3.2 until the codec fix ships. Don't scale past six workers; memory spikes return. If the queue's encrypted config store locks after a worker crash, the unlock tool will ask for the recovery passphrase given below.

unlock words, hahip-baduf: holwyn-istath-julvan

TICKET-208: ScanBridge firmware push failing signature check on the barcode scanner integration. Happens on every Vexlar SR-2 unit since yesterday's update — looks like the devices still trust the old cert. Workaround for support: don't retry, it just re-fails. Fix ships tonight once devices fetch the new trust bundle. The replacement signing key is included below.

signing key of bagap-yawep = bky13_TbfT6ZMUoGJo2

- [ ] Step 7: Archive cold storage buckets (Glacierline tier). Confirm both ceremony witnesses are present, verify bucket manifests match the Oxbow ledger, then seal the archive key shares. Plugin authors may observe but not handle shares. Once sealed, the archive index itself is encrypted and can only be reopened with the passphrase below.

vault phrase of badup-hahig = tamael-aldael-kelmir-istael-fenok-istwyn-tamius-jorath-oliion